問題タブ [http-get]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
278 参照

android - パーサー、引数を送信/xml を受信 (受信済み/送信していない)

私はxmlを受け取り、それをリストにコピーするこの関数を持っています。これはうまく実装されています。私が知りたいのは、カテゴリ (関数の引数のように受け取るもの) を送信し、そのカテゴリから食べ物だけを受け取ることです。

サーバーは、カテゴリを受信し、そのカテゴリから食品を送信する準備ができています。
カテゴリを送信して正しい xml を受信するにはどうすればよいですか?

0 投票する
5 に答える
34157 参照

php - POST と GET の両方をフォームで送信する

POST と GET リクエストの両方を送信するフォームを作成する必要があります (IE と iframe のバグのため)。

送信されるデータはそれほど安全なものではないため、GET 経由で設定できるかどうかは問題ではありません。両方の方法で設定されていることを確認する必要があります。

助けてくれてありがとう!

0 投票する
2 に答える
1024 参照

asp.net-mvc - asp.net mvc で HTTP GET フォームを正規化するのに助けが必要です

ページング、並べ替え、検索の 3 つの目的を果たす asp.net mvc サイトにフォームがあります。正しい検索結果を返すかどうかは、3 つの側面すべての変数に依存するため、これらのアイテムはすべて同じ形式でレンダリングする必要があります。私がやろうとしているのは、パラメーターをクエリ文字列から移動し、正規の URL に配置することです。

これまでのところ、3 つのルート構成があります (エリア、コントローラー、およびアクション名に T4MVC を使用)。

ビュー内のフォームは、次の構文を使用して CanonicalizeSearch ルートに送信されます。

MyWidgetsController には、2 つのアクション メソッドがあります。

これは、キーワードを除くすべてのクエリ文字列変数を正規化されたルートに移動するために機能します。最初のルートにキーワード パラメータを追加すると、CanonicalizeSearch アクションは、キーワードが null、空、または空白でない場合にのみ Search アクションにリダイレクトされます。キーワードが入力されていない場合、ページの結果を閲覧できなくなるため、これは良くありません。

私はすべてを試したと思います-キーワードにコントローラーのデフォルト値を与え、他の3つのパラメーターにキーワードを追加する4番目のルートを追加するなど。ただし、これを機能させる唯一の方法は、キーワードをそのままにしておくことですクエリ文字列パラメーター。(実際には、CanonicalizeSearch でキーワードの前にアンダースコアを追加し、Search で削除することで機能させることができますが、これはかなりハックです)。

何か助けはありますか?

0 投票する
2 に答える
968 参照

python - Python で $_GET および $_POST クエリ文字列またはフォーム値に相当するものにアクセスする

PHP では、次のようにクエリ文字列で値を取得できます。

したがって、リクエスト URI がhttp://example.com/index.php?foo=barの場合

上記のコードを Python でエミュレートするにはどうすればよいですか? (重い Web フレームワークを使用していない)

Python でこれを行う最も簡単な方法についての簡単なドキュメントが見つかりません。着信 HTTP 要求を処理するための標準 Python ライブラリはありますか? Python がテンプレート言語ではないことは知っていますが、Web で広く使用されていることから、これを処理する簡単な方法があるはずです。

0 投票する
2 に答える
7638 参照

forms - GETを使用してJSFフォームを送信する

同じページにフォームを送信してGETパラメーターを使用するにはどうすればよいですか?

JSFページの内容:

ページform.jsf?item1 = foo&item2 = barをリクエストすると、テキストフィールドに入力されますが、フォームの送信自体が機能していないようです。

0 投票する
1 に答える
8547 参照

android - Android httpclient と utf-8

私のクエリがいくつかのデータを保持している Web サービスに接続しようとしています。悪いことに、このデータには utf-8 文字が含まれているため、問題が発生します。

通常の文字列で単に HttpGet を呼び出すと、「不正な文字」例外が発生します。それで、私はググって、いくつかのutf-8マジックを試しました。

これで、不正な文字は取得されなくなりましたが、代わりに「ターゲット ホストが null になってはならない、またはパラメーターで設定されてはならない」というメッセージが表示されるため、utfurl が完全に台無しになっているようです。おそらく、めちゃくちゃな文字列の「http://」の部分を認識していないためです。何かアドバイス?

よろしく

0 投票する
2 に答える
1356 参照

android - HttpClient が実際のデバイスで動作しない

このコードを使用して、Web サーバーに対して HttpGet 要求を実行します。エミュレーターでは問題なく動作しますが、私の HTC Sense では動作しません。実行は、http リクエストを実行せずに終了します。何か案が ?

0 投票する
1 に答える
137 参照

asp.net - マスターページを備えた非常にシンプルな Web フォーム

method=get を使用して、ある Web フォームから別の Web フォームにデータを送信します。しかし、URL クエリに次のようなものを含めたくありません。

Search.aspx?__EVENTTARGET=&__EVENTARGUMENT=&__VIEWSTATE=%2FwEPDwUKLTYwODIwNTg5MQ9kFgJmD2QWAgIDDxYCHgZtZXRob2QFA2dldGRkGOirvzjoAxt%2BfOb915%2FpsYZXmAxLZZdpnK6UW7A9%2Fk83D&__PREVIOUSPAGE=cog5Yzt_1GerH9r2ERTIPbLWMCwMFYteZjmDYCbBO3vobCG4C_mWM7GZMNuBesyAjw77cvuNKl_aSUYzeajiW6W0CjI0tLB6ikjcM4t5Kbg1&__EVENTVALIDATION=%2FwEWAgKYsPjPDQKY24%2FQBBH4CPejKl3spy0A%2BtpMxb%2BCGVGJf73dYtmaEnIFF4IR&name=Amy&state=24&ctl00%24MainContent%24submit=Searchbut

名前と状態だけを次のように Get クエリに入れたい:

?name=エイミー&state=24

0 投票する
1 に答える
1946 参照

asp.net - HTTP-GET Web サービス コンシューマーの C# ASP.NET の例

公開された HTTP-GET Web サービスを使用する ASP.NET Web アプリケーション (C#) の例を探しているだけです。

オンラインで簡単に見つけられるはずですが、まだ見つけていません。

0 投票する
1 に答える
757 参照

android - Android: HTML ファイルを読み込もうとするとアプリがハングする

次の Android コードを使用して、インターネット上の HTML ページに接続し、数行を抽出します。ほとんどの場合、コードは正常に実行されますが、ハングすることがあります。「強制終了」ダイアログを表示するには、モバイルの戻るボタンを押す必要があります。ただし、エミュレーターでは常に正常に動作します (PC で高速接続を使用します)。

  1. 携帯電話の EDGE/GPRS 接続が遅いためにコードがハングしているのでしょうか?
  2. ソケットのタイムアウトを挿入する必要がありますか?
  3. コードがハングする他の理由は何ですか?
  4. コードがハングしないようにするにはどうすればよいですか? エラーをトラップして、再試行する前にユーザーにメッセージを返す方法はありますか?

助けてください。